Best way to replace them is to take an existing one to a hardware store and find a match. You're lucky both my Sunraders have these huge holes in the doors for this latch

JR Products Shur-latch | Omni Outdoor Living

Expensive to replace. I did a work around and now all my doors close with heavy duty magnet latches. 

Stuff in cabinets also goes into baskets so nothing heavy pushes on the doors.

that stuff is dialectric silicon. its a corrosion preventative.  buy it auto parts stores

  and yes the led lights above would work.  more for you to do

Link to comment
Share on other sites

i changed all mine to leds no problems with making connection.  cheap on amazon-  equivalent to 1157 thats in there now.  1156 for the back up bulb
